我在搜索“apt 损坏”问题时没有看到任何相关结果,除了这个话题。我记得设置了 VirtualBox 并以某种方式设法使其工作,但是这个终端输出不断重复,也许还有其他隐藏的后果。
所以我测试了:
sudo dpkg --configure -a
希望它能将 apt 重新初始化为默认参数。但是,它在每个“apt install”命令之后不断重复以下文本。
Setting up virtualbox-dkms (6.1.16-dfsg-6~ubuntu1.20.04.2) ...
Removing old virtualbox-6.1.16 DKMS files...
------------------------------
Deleting module version: 6.1.16
completely from the DKMS tree.
------------------------------
Done.
Loading new virtualbox-6.1.16 DKMS files...
Building for 5.13.0-52-generic
Building initial module for 5.13.0-52-generic
ERROR: Cannot create report: [Errno 17] File exists: '/var/crash/virtualbox-dkms.0.crash'
Error! Bad return status for module build on kernel: 5.13.0-52-generic (x86_64)
Consult /var/lib/dkms/virtualbox/6.1.16/build/make.log for more information.
dpkg: error processing package virtualbox-dkms (--configure):
installed virtualbox-dkms package post-installation script subprocess returned error exit status 10
Errors were encountered while processing:
virtualbox-dkms
E: Sub-process /usr/bin/dpkg returned an error code (1)
'cat /var/lib/dkms/virtualbox/6.1.16/build/make.log' 的输出是:
DKMS make.log for virtualbox-6.1.16 for kernel 5.13.0-52-generic (x86_64)
Sat 9 Jul 11:02:23 +04 2022
make: Entering directory '/usr/src/linux-headers-5.13.0-52-generic'
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/linux/SUPDrv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/SUPDrv.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/SUPDrvGip.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/SUPDrvSem.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/SUPDrvTracer.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/SUPLibAll.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/alloc-r0drv.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/initterm-r0drv.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/memobj-r0drv.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/mpnotification-r0drv.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/powernotification-r0drv.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/assert-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/alloc-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/initterm-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/memobj-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/memuserkernel-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/mp-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/mpnotification-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/process-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/rtStrFormatKernelAddress-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/semevent-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/semeventmulti-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/semfastmutex-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/semmutex-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/spinlock-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/thread-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/thread2-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/threadctxhooks-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/time-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/timer-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/generic/semspinmutex-r0drv-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/alloc/alloc.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/checksum/crc32.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/checksum/ipv4.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/checksum/ipv6.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/err/RTErrConvertFromErrno.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/err/RTErrConvertToErrno.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/err/errinfo.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/log/log.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/log/logellipsis.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/log/logrel.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/log/logrelellipsis.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/log/logcom.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/log/logformat.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/misc/RTAssertMsg1Weak.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/misc/RTAssertMsg2.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/misc/RTAssertMsg2Add.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/misc/RTAssertMsg2AddWeak.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/misc/RTAssertMsg2AddWeakV.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/misc/RTAssertMsg2Weak.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/misc/RTAssertMsg2WeakV.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/misc/assert.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/misc/handletable.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/misc/handletablectx.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/misc/thread.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/string/RTStrCat.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/string/RTStrCopy.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/string/RTStrCopyEx.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/string/RTStrCopyP.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/string/RTStrNCmp.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/string/RTStrNLen.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/string/stringalloc.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/string/strformat.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/string/strformatnum.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/string/strformatrt.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/string/strformattype.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/string/strprintf.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/string/strtonum.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/table/avlpv.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/time/time.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/r0drv/linux/RTLogWriteDebugger-r0drv-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/generic/RTAssertShouldPanic-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/generic/RTLogWriteStdErr-stub-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/generic/RTLogWriteStdOut-stub-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/generic/RTLogWriteUser-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/generic/RTMpGetArraySize-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/generic/RTMpGetCoreCount-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/generic/RTSemEventWait-2-ex-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/generic/RTSemEventWaitNoResume-2-ex-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/generic/RTSemEventMultiWait-2-ex-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/generic/RTSemEventMultiWaitNoResume-2-ex-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/generic/RTTimerCreate-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/generic/errvars-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/generic/mppresent-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/generic/uuid-generic.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/VBox/log-vbox.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/common/alloc/heapsimple.o
LD [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xdrv/vboxdrv.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xnetflt/linux/VBoxNetFlt-linux.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xnetflt/VBoxNetFlt.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xnetflt/SUPR0IdcClient.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xnetflt/SUPR0IdcClientComponent.o
CC [M] /var/lib/dkms/virtualbox/6.1.16/build/vboxnetflt/linux/SUPR0IdcClient-linux.o
/var/lib/dkms/virtualbox/6.1.16/build/vboxnetflt/linux/VBoxNetFlt-linux.c: In function ‘vboxNetFltNeedsLinkState’:
/var/lib/dkms/virtualbox/6.1.16/build/vboxnetflt/linux/VBoxNetFlt-linux.c:1761:47: error: dereferencing pointer to incomplete type ‘const struct ethtool_ops’
1761 | if (pDev->ethtool_ops && pDev->ethtool_ops->get_drvinfo)
| ^~
/var/lib/dkms/virtualbox/6.1.16/build/vboxnetflt/linux/VBoxNetFlt-linux.c:1763:32: error: storage size of ‘Info’ isn’t known
1763 | struct ethtool_drvinfo Info;
| ^~~~
/var/lib/dkms/virtualbox/6.1.16/build/vboxnetflt/linux/VBoxNetFlt-linux.c:1766:20: error: ‘ETHTOOL_GDRVINFO’ undeclared (first use in this function)
1766 | Info.cmd = ETHTOOL_GDRVINFO;
| ^~~~~~~~~~~~~~~~
/var/lib/dkms/virtualbox/6.1.16/build/vboxnetflt/linux/VBoxNetFlt-linux.c:1766:20: note: each undeclared identifier is reported only once for each function it appears in
/var/lib/dkms/virtualbox/6.1.16/build/vboxnetflt/linux/VBoxNetFlt-linux.c:1763:32: warning: unused variable ‘Info’ [-Wunused-variable]
1763 | struct ethtool_drvinfo Info;
| ^~~~
make[2]: *** [scripts/Makefile.build:281: /var/lib/dkms/virtualbox/6.1.16/build/vboxnetflt/linux/VBoxNetFlt-linux.o] Error 1
make[1]: *** [scripts/Makefile.build:524: /var/lib/dkms/virtualbox/6.1.16/build/vboxnetflt] Error 2
make: *** [Makefile:1879: /var/lib/dkms/virtualbox/6.1.16/build] Error 2
make: Leaving directory '/usr/src/linux-headers-5.13.0-52-generic'